#e20ef0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e20ef0 is composed of 88.6% red, 5.5%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.8% cyan, 94.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 296.3 degrees, a saturation of 89% and a lightness of 49.8%. #e20ef0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1cff with #c500e1. Closest websafe color is: #cc00ff.

Shades and Tints of #e20ef0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110112 is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#e20ef0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#847985 is the less saturated color, while #eb04fa is the most saturated one.
